As an example, if you were 40% responsible and the other motorist was 60% responsible, you may be able to recover 60% of your overall damages from the various other vehicle driver. In states that comply with comparative carelessness regulations, an at-fault motorist can still file a claim against an additional celebration if both chauffeurs share duty. Most of the times, an at-fault driver can not demand damages associated with the accident they created, especially if they are discovered to be fully liable.
